Ann Arbor Public SchoolsPOSITION TITLE
Extended School Year (ESY) Lead TeacherEMPLOYMENT PERIOD
June 30th•July 31st. 9:00 am•Noon.POSITION LOCATION
Allen Elementary SALARY:
$41.59/hour (per AAEA contract)REPORTING RELATIONSHIP
OSE ESY AdministratorQUALIFICATIONS REQUIREMENTS
To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actory.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. The following is a list of qualifications for the position, any one of which may be waived by the Board in exercising its prerogative to determine qualifications.E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E
Posses a current, valid Michigan Teaching Certificate with certification at appropriate level. Posses a special education certification. Posses current, valid professional licensure, if appropriate. Have work experience with children with disabilities, preferably those with severe learning disabilities, cognitive impairments or on the autism spectrum. Possess a willingness to work with other teachers, collaborate and align instructional practice, and coordinate daily instruction between all practitioners. Possess a willingness to commit to professional development opportunities. Demonstrate proficiency with instructional techniques such as: Use of ongoing assessment information to differentiate instruction. Use of active learning, manipulatives and visual displays to scaffold students' understanding of concepts and numerical relationships. Strategic use of classroom conversations through which students construct meaning and understanding.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Facilitate maintenance of student IEP goals/objectives, including self-care and communication. Facilitate program activities and student engagement. Direct Teaching Assistant staff as needed. Implement student BIPs, Health Plans and Communication plans, etc. Complete pre/post assessments. Collect data for targeted goals and objectives and share summary with Fall teacher. Communicate regularly with student's parents. Regular and reliable attendance. Other related duties as assigned.LANGUAGE SKILLS
